1. Kolkata Knight Riders

The Kolkata Knight Riders (KKR) finished the campaign at No. 8 after winning the title last year. They didn't have a great start to the auction, failing to secure the services of their title-winning skipper, Shreyas Iyer. However, they turned heads by signing Venkatesh Iyer for a whopping INR 23.75 crore. They didn't have a huge budget heading into the auction, as they had already retained six players. The hefty amount given to Venkatesh meant there was not much money left to spend on the rest of the players.

KKR depended on their retentions, and most of them didn't come to the party. While Sunil Narine and Varun Chakaravarthy were brilliant, Andre Russell, Rinku Singh, Ramandeep Singh, and Harshit Rana failed to live up to their reputations. Russell did play a few good knocks towards the backend, but KKR's campaign was already doomed by then. Anrich Nortje and Spencer Johnson couldn't replicate the performances of Mitchell Starc in the previous edition. Phil Salt's absence at the top of the order was also felt.
